How to search my entire computer?

I had a explorer window open, not sure which location but I closed in in a hurry and right before I noticed a folder I have been looking for. When I use the search function, it does not pull everything. I have readjusted the settings in there as advised before, but it still doesn't search everywhere. For example, I have things on my desktop, and if I type in the name, it doesn't appear.


So, how do I do a complete file name search for everything on my computer?

Download and try "Everything" from voidtools.com

Free. Lightning quick. Easily configured. You can tell it what drives to include in a search.

It searches ONLY names, not contents.

Agent Ransack is another good search tool.
